My One year old English Bulldog was at a pet resort last weekend.  When we picked her up four days later she had a terrible rash on the under portion of her neck.  We did include a play in the kiddy pool in her stay.  I am wondering if she became irritated after the water play and then had her collar on while she was wet...I'm not sure..The area is pretty large and she has lost the hair in that area.  She does not seemed to be bothered by it but I am concerned.  She just recently had a bump removed from her leg...and it was fine but stressful.  I'm wondering if there is a cream i could use or a certain shampoo that may help.

Lynn

Answer
Hi Lynn:
Well, the idea you have sounds correct!  At least I hope this is the problem.  Keep her collar off when she is in the house.  Put some E.M.T. gel or spray on the area... This is like an invisable bandaid for the skin.  Her area can still breath thru this light covering.  Or, you can buy some baby corn starch powder and pat small amounts in the area. ( don't put too much because it will go up her nose)

Also, you may want to give her 100 IU of Vitamin E , 1 per day for a few weeks.  ( reduces inflammation).

If the area is red and has drainage, then I would make a visit to the vet office.  ( she may need antibiotics)
